Hugh Lane Gallery – FREE

It\’s back open and if you\’ve never been now is a great time to visit the Hugh Lane Gallery in Parnell Square, Dublin 1. You\’ll find some of the most stunning paintings in 20th century European art including Monet’s Waterloo Bridge or Manet’s Music in the Tuileries Gardens. This is also home to the Francis Bacon Studio. The famous Irish painter spent much of his creative life in London. When he died his Soho studio was transferred to Dublin – wall by wall, brush by brush, photo by photo. It is an amazing insight into the workings of a creative mind.

Traditional Music – Devitt\’s Pub, Camden Street, Dublin 2 – Saturday 7.45pm

Traditional Irish music sessions in central Dublin are fast becoming a thing of the past, and the total number of pubs offering trad is now in single figures.

Music sessions in Devitt’s have an authenticity you won’t come by in other pubs; that could be down to the locals taking part and joining in, and at times the whole pub singing together, to both trad and more contemporary songs. Come on down and have some socially distant fun.
